Feeling Pregnant after baby

I had a little girl November 1st, 2010. It's been about 2 months and all my pregnancy symptoms have come back and it's depressing me so very badly! At one point I thought I was pregnant because I did have unprotected sex but my test came up negative.
I'm feeling tired all the time, I feel like throwing up none stop. I'm always dizzy and my acid reflux and heart burn is back. I also have those little bumps on my nipples that is almost a deffanant sign of pregnancy.
Can someone tell me why I'm feeling this way? I could have possibly had a false negative or something? Or is there any way to get this back in check.
